Analysis
In 2006, discrepancy in gdp, value added in Djibouti stood at 0 current LCU.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 100.0% over five years.
Over the whole period, discrepancy in gdp, value added in Djibouti peaked at 100,000 current LCU in 2001 and was at its lowest, -100,000 current LCU, in 2003.
Djibouti ranks 27th of 51 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
This is the discrepancy included in the value added of services, etc. Covered here are any discrepancies noted by national compilers as well as discrepancies arising from linking new and old series in the World Bank data base. Data are in current local currency.
